81523
ZIP 81523 is wealthier than most US places, with a median household income of $106,518. Population has held roughly steady since 2024. Median home value is $761,200. With a median age of 65.5, the population is older than the US median of 38.9. Poverty is rare here, at 1.0% of residents. Households here earn about 45% more than the Mesa County median. Among the 16 ZIP codes in Mesa County, 81523 ranks 4th by median household income.
How many people live in ZIP code 81523?
ZIP code 81523 has about 983 residents according to the 2024 American Community Survey.
What is the median household income in ZIP code 81523?
The typical household in ZIP code 81523 earns about $106,518 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.
Is ZIP code 81523 expensive?
In ZIP code 81523, the median home is worth about $761,200.
How educated are people in ZIP code 81523?
About 38.7% of adults age 25 and over in ZIP code 81523 h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
What is the poverty rate in ZIP code 81523?
About 1.0% of people in ZIP code 81523 live below the federal poverty line.
